Cheri Bibi. 1973.
Bronze with dark red-brown greenish patina.
Verso of edge of plinth with name, number and foundry mark "Cire Valsuani Perdue". One of 175 copies. 33,5 x 18,5 x 15,5 cm (13,1 x 7,2 x 6,1 in).
Cast by Valsuani Paris. All in all, three editions with different degrees of patination are in existence. Made after a gipsum model from 1964. [KP].
LITERATURE: Jürgen Pech, Lieber Bibi, in: Max Ernst - Plastische Werke, Cologne 2005, p. 206 (with color illu. on page 207).
